Analytical Characterization of Cyadox and Metabolites

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Cyx (C12H9N5O3, CAS NO. 65884-46-0, molecular weight 271.23 g/mol, 98% purity) and four of its major metabolites including 1,4-bidesoxycyadox (Cy1), cyadox-1-monoxide (Cy2), N-(quinoxaline-2-methyl)-cyanide acetyl hydrazine (Cy4) and quinoxaline-2-carboxylic acid (Cy6) were the product of Institute of Veterinary Pharmaceuticals, Huazhong Agricultural University (Wuhan, China). Other chemicals such as polyvinylpyrrolidone K30 (PVP), hydrochloric acid (HCL), methanol (MeOH), d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O), sodium hydroxide (NaOH), potassium dihydrogen phosphate (KH2PO4), sodium chloride (NaCl), ethanol (C2H5OH), potassium chloride (KCl), disodium hydrogen phosphate dodecahydrate (Na2HPO4.12H2O), carbon tetrachloride (CCl4) N, N-dimethylformamide (DMF), acetonitrile (CH3CN), and acetone (CH3COCH3) were commercially obtained from Sinopharm Chemical Reagent Co., Ltd.(Shanghai, China). Deionized water, used for all experiments, was purified using Millipore® purified water system (Milli-Q Co., Ltd, France). All other chemicals and reagents used in this experiment were of highly analytical grade.

Whole Blood-Derived Silica Nanoparticles

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Tetraethoxysilane ([TEOS], 96%), ammonia (25%), sulphuric acid (98%), hydrogen peroxide (40%), sodium dodecyl sulphate ([SDS], 95%), Tween 20 (95%), Tween 80 (95%), cetyltrimethyl ammonium bromide ([CTAB], 99%), Triton X-100 (95%), polyvinylpyrrolidone-K30 ([PVP K-30], 95%) and 5-sulfosalicylic acid (95%) were purchased from the Sinopharm Chemical Reagent Co., Ltd (Shanghai, China). Ethanol was purchased from the TEDIA Company (Fairfield, OH, USA). All of the solvents and chemicals used were of analytical quality and were used without further purification unless indicated.
Whole blood was donated by the authors and stored in evacuated glass blood collection tubes containing 0.1 mg/mL EDTA (BD Vacutainer, Shanghai, China) at –25 °C. It was thawed to room temperature before use.
